RK&K is seeking a Natural Resources Project Scientist in Atlanta, GA with strong wetland expertise to support a variety of environmental and natural resource projects. This role involves fieldwork, data analysis, technical reporting, and coordination with engineers, planners, and regulatory agencies to support permitting, compliance, and environmental stewardship efforts.
Essential Functions
- Support natural resource and environmental projects from planning through execution and reporting
- Conduct field investigations including wetland delineations, hydrology/soil assessments, vegetation surveys, habitat assessments, and ecological monitoring
- Collect, analyze, and interpret environmental, biological, and geospatial data
- Prepare technical reports, wetland delineation reports, mitigation plans, environmental assessments, and permit applications
- Support regulatory permitting efforts under federal, state, and local regulations (e.g., USACE Section 404/401, EPA, NC DEQ)
- Coordinate with multidisciplinary project teams, including engineers, planners, and construction staff
- Participate in client meetings and agency coordination as needed
- Maintain accurate field notes, data records, and project documentation
- Support project schedules, budgets, and quality control standards
